1 definition by Shoodbwerking

Top Definition
Addictively wasting hours on Urban Dictionary when you have very important, urgent work to do, even though the mental hiatus could result in suspension, contract termination, social expulsion or in some cases death.

(verb) Urbanastinate.
Ryan: "Check out this new word I found on Urban Dictionary last night"
Andrew: "No ways man. Last time I was caught Urbanastinating in my cubicle I was given a final warning"
Ryan: "Dude, thats why I always urbanastinate in the privacy of my own room"
by Shoodbwerking December 02, 2010

Mug icon
Buy a Urbanastinating mug!